The Reasons Why Regular Auto Repair Proves Essential for Your Vehicles Longevity

Regular auto repair is essential for maintaining a vehicle's longevity. Routine maintenance tasks, such as brake assessments and oil changes, help prevent substantial difficulties down the line. These practices not only enhance performance but also ensure safety on the road. By adhering to recommended service schedules, drivers can improve fuel efficiency and minimize costs. However, the question remains: what distinct rewards emerge from a consistent repair routine?

Why Does Consistent Vehicle Maintenance Avoid Major Failures?

How do regular auto repair practices substantially reduce the risk of major vehicle issues? Regular inspections and timely repairs play an essential role in vehicle maintenance. By addressing minor concerns before they escalate, drivers can avert costly breakdowns and extensive damage. Regular checks of critical components like brakes, tires, and fluid levels allow for the identification of wear and tear. This proactive approach helps guarantee that vehicles operate smoothly and safely.

Furthermore, mechanics can identify issues that might not be immediately apparent to the driver, such as engine misfires or transmission issues. Ignoring these warning signs can bring about serious mechanical failures, often causing high-cost repairs or even accidents. By maintaining a schedule of regular auto repair, vehicle owners not only enhance safety but also extend the lifespan of their automobiles, ultimately saving time and money in the long run.

Improves Fuel Efficiency

Taking care of a vehicle not only assists in avoiding major breakdowns but also plays a substantial role in enhancing fuel efficiency. Routine maintenance, such as oil changes, air filter replacements, and tire rotations, guarantees that all components of the vehicle function effectively. A well-lubricated engine runs more smoothly, consuming less fuel. Additionally, properly inflated tires minimize rolling resistance, which directly impacts fuel consumption. Neglecting maintenance can cause clogged fuel injectors or dirty air filters, causing the engine to work harder and waste fuel. By engaging in routine auto repair, vehicle owners can enjoy improved mileage and reduced fuel expenses. Ultimately, consistent maintenance not only extends the life of the vehicle but also supports a more economical and environmentally friendly driving experience.

How Routine Maintenance Enhances Your Vehicle's Fuel Economy

Routine maintenance plays a crucial role in improving a vehicle's fuel efficiency. Scheduled maintenance, such as air filter replacements and oil changes, guarantees the engine performs optimally. A properly lubricated engine decreases friction, allowing for better fuel combustion. Moreover, examining tire pressure and alignment is crucial; under-inflated or poorly aligned tires can increase rolling resistance, causing higher fuel consumption.

Moreover, regular servicing includes assessments of fuel injectors and exhaust systems, which can significantly impact performance. Clean fuel injectors enable efficient fuel delivery, while a properly functioning exhaust system prevents back pressure that can impede engine efficiency.

In addition, mechanics often identify and rectify minor defects before they escalate, confirming that all components perform harmoniously. Finally, continual maintenance not only lengthens the longevity of the vehicle but also enhances fuel efficiency, producing an overall enhanced driving experience.

How Often Should You Arrange Auto Repairs?

Despite many vehicle owners potentially dismissing the significance of scheduling auto repairs, doing so at regular intervals is vital for preserving a vehicle's health and longevity. Usually, it is wise to schedule maintenance checks every 5,000 to 7,500 miles, according to the vehicle's make and model. This frequency helps mechanics to spot potential issues before they turn into substantial problems.

In addition to mileage-based intervals, vehicle owners should also be aware of seasonal changes, as extreme temperatures can impact engine performance and tire conditions. Regular inspections should include oil changes, brake checks, and tire rotations. Furthermore, specific components, such as belts and hoses, may require attention based on the manufacturer's recommendations.

What Are the Signs That My Car Needs Immediate Repair?

Symptoms demonstrating a vehicle requires immediate repair include peculiar noises, warning lights on the dashboard, smoke or strange odors, fluid leaks, diminished braking performance, and difficulty starting the engine. Timely attention can prevent further damage.

Can I Do Vehicle Repairs on My Own to Save Money?

Car owners may conduct auto repairs independently to save money, assuming they have the proper tools, know-how, and proficiency. However, caution is advised, as improper repairs may lead to further issues and increased costs.

How Do I Select a Dependable Auto Repair Shop?

To pick a trustworthy auto repair shop, consider these steps: seek recommendations, look at online reviews, confirm certifications, visit the shop for cleanliness and organization, and inquire about warranties on services to ensure reliability and quality.

Can I Complete Specific Maintenance Tasks at Home?

Home maintenance is possible for individuals to perform basic tasks, such as checking tire pressure, changing engine oil, replacing air filters, and checking brake pads. These activities help ensure vehicle performance and can stop more significant issues.

What Are the Consequences of Skipping Regular Auto Repairs?

Skipping regular auto service can lead to lowered vehicle performance, higher repair costs, safety hazards, and potential breakdowns. Over time, ignoring maintenance may cause irreversible damage, ultimately decreasing the vehicle's lifespan and reliability.
